I was warned by several big name guys against side exits there for at the track. If you have a rich enuff air fuel ratio while on the brake building boost you can inadvertently trip the staging lights. Might not be a big concern if you can get a bit of back and down angle on them. Just something to watch out for. I think it looks great myself.
